Election Information:
Contest Type: State-run Primary
Election Date:2008-02-05
Eligible Participants: Modified Open (members of the party or independents)
Delegates Awarded in this Contest: 370
Delegates Total: 441
Delegate Allocation Method: Proportional - the candidates are awarded delegates in proportion to the percentage of votes received. A 15% threshold is required to receive delegates.
  • 129 at-large delegates
  • 241 district delegates
  • 71 unpledged delegates
    • 3 delegates from CDs 20, 47
    • 4 delegates from CDs 2, 3, 11, 16, 18, 19, 21, 22, 25, 26, 31, 32, 34, 38, 39, 40, 41, 42, 43, 44, 45, 46, 48, 49, 51, 52
    • 5 delegates from CDs 1, 4, 5, 7, 10, 13, 15, 17, 23, 24, 27, 28, 29, 33, 35, 36, 37, 50, 53
    • 6 delegates from CDs 6, 8, 9, 12, 14, 30
